Dawn Marlan on the Pandemic 

Dawn Marlan, Lecturer in Comparative Literature, has published two pieces on the experiences of women during the Covid pandemic, both of which appeared in (Her)oics: Women’s Lived Experi​​ences During the Coronavirus Pandemic (Pact Press, 2021). They are “Tomorrow or Today,” and “The One that Hurts Less” (co-written with Kristen Marinovich).  

Marlan also gave a public reading of personal essays she contributed to the anthology Fury: Women’s Lived Experiences in the Trump Era (‎Regal House Publishing, 2020.
